The matrix comes to lung transplantation TRANSPLANTATION Babu, A. N., Nicolls, M. R. 2007; 83 (6): 683-684
Abstract
Lung transplantation is complicated by fibroproliferation, which is likely mediated in part by mat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) and tissue inhibitors of MMPs. This commentary briefly discusses what is known about these mediators in fibrotic pulmonary diseases and how an important new study by Yoshida and colleagues sheds light on the diverse functions of these proteins in alloimmune inflammation.
